Bolsanaro not acknowledging election loss

From Morning Report, 6:45 am on 2 November 2022

Brazillians have elected a new president - but outgoing president Jair Bolsanaro refuses to acknowldge the voters' decision.

Since the results came in yesterday Bolsanaro has remained silent, neither conceeding defeat nor challenging rival Lula's win.

There is a two-month transition period before Lula is due to be sworn in, and concerns that the transition may not be a smooth one are mounting.

Lorry drivers in Brazil loyal to President Jair Bolsonaro blocked roads across the nation after election results were announced - federal highway police reported 342 such incidents, with the biggest protests in the country's south.
